Position Summary We are currently seeking a Full-Time Tech Aide to join our team at a fast-paced outpatient imaging center in Ocala, FL. The ideal candidate will provide exceptional customer service while accurately obtaining and entering patient demographic and insurance information into our Radiology Information System (RIS). Key Responsibilities Facilitate patient flow by assisting patients in preparation for exams, including dressing/undressing and starting/removing IVs as needed Work independently to ensure steady patient flow and communicate any delays to patients and their families Set up instruments and equipment according to department protocols Clean and disinfect exam/procedure rooms, instruments, and equipment between patient visits to maintain infection control Call or fax STAT results to ordering providers and enter documentation into the RIS What You Will Need High school diploma or GED Minimum of one (1) year of related experience Strong customer service and communication skills Benefits As a valued employee of Radiology Associates, you ll enjoy a comprehensive benefits package, including: 15 days of Paid Time Off (PTO) 8 Paid Holidays Affordable Medical, Dental, and Vision Insurance Paid Life and AD&D Insurance Employee Assistance Program (EAP) Travel Assistance and Identity Theft Protection Employee Recognition Programs Corporate Discounts 401(k) Retirement Plan Employee Referral Bonus Program Additional Information Equal Opportunity Employer Radiology Associates is an Equal Opportunity Employer and complies with all federal, state, and local anti-discrimination laws and regulations.
